We are seeking a highly organized and detail-oriented individual to join our team as a Legal Assistant. As a Legal Assistant, you will provide essential support to our legal team, assisting with various tasks to ensure the smooth operation of our legal department.
We are a personal injury law firm located in White Plains, New York. Our team has extensive experience in handling a wide variety of personal injury cases including construction accidents, motor vehicle accidents, slip and fall accidents, and hospital negligence cases.
Duties:
- Assist with drafting legal documents, such as pleadings and responses to discovery demands for Plaintiff's personal injury firm.
- Manage and organize legal files and documents.
- Perform data entry and maintain accurate records of client information.
- Assist attorneys in preparing for trials, hearings, and meetings.
- Coordinate and schedule appointments, meetings, and court appearances.
- Maintain confidentiality of sensitive information.
- Answer phone calls and handle inquiries with professionalism and excellent phone etiquette.
-Familiar with New York Labor Law 240(1) and 241(6).
-Fluent in Spanish required.
We offer competitive compensation based on experience. This is a full-time position with opportunities for growth within our organization. If you are a motivated individual with a passion for the legal field, we encourage you to apply for the Legal Assistant position.
